About Sunil Kumar
Sunil Kumar is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ology, Pharmacology, Pharmacology and Complementary and alternative medicine, having authored 70 papers that have together received 1.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Berberine and alkaloids research (13 papers), Alkaloids: synthesis and pharmacology (10 papers), Essential Oils and Antimicrobial Activity (9 papers), Phytochemistry and Biological Activities (8 papers), Ethnobotanical and Medicinal Plants Studies (8 papers), Natural Antidiabetic Agents Studies (7 papers), Phytochemicals and Medicinal Plants (7 papers) and Traditional and Medicinal Uses of Annonaceae (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(265 citations), Pharmacology (366 citations), Complementary and alternative medicine (324 citations), Plant Science (762 citations) and Food Science (322 citations). Sunil Kumar has collaborated with scholars based in India, Germany and United States. Frequent co-authors include Awantika Singh, Brijesh Kumar, Bikarma Singh, Vikas Bajpai, Vikas Bajpai, Mukesh Srivastava, Ramesh Singh, Pradeep Singh, R. L. Khosa and Ramesh Kumar Verma.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Ethnopharmacology, Rapid Communications in Mass Spectrometry, Industrial Crops and Products, Natural Product Communications and Journal of Pharmaceutical Analysis.
